Re: TOO much contrast?
yeha, the bass seems to be missing from the big(ch) sections. Too missing for me. Especially when it(thebass) sounded so well thought out in the verses. It feels like the sound of the mix in the choruses would be great for some kind of breakdown, but I miss the low end not being there every time.your production tricks are fabulous, and very current sounding to me, great solo & sound too. the overall mix compression and eq might be a little too intense. I wonder if the extra dynamics in the chorus might be enhanced by not using as much compression. It might be good to allow the chorus to get louder and not squash it so much.But it is an awesome piece of work. Great to hear it!
